We see the two of them driving away into the rising sun. Disha is behind the wheel, and she assures Amar that she'll take him somewhere safe and stay with him at all times. Amar gets to thinking about how screwed up this all sounds, and tells her to stop the car. He feels he needs to go back and make sure his name is clear. Disha strongly protests this plan and refuses to stop. Amar does the normal thing that most of us would do in a speeding car that is traveling on a narrow road on the side of a mountain - he grabs for the wheel. They jerk the car back and forth a few times, and jar the door of the glove compartment open. Inside we can see the fakest looking knife I've seen in a long time, covered with blood. Amar lets go of the wheel, and it all starts to sink in. He accuses Disha of killing the people at the cottage so that she'd have a reason to go along and hide with Amar.

Amar is horrified when Disha doesn't refute any of his accusations. She merely says that she loves him. Amar tells her that she will never be able to "achieve him," (seriously) and that she really needs to stop the car. She still thinks that's a bad plan, and they fight over the wheel again. They carry on like this for a moment or two, until the car skids on some snow and they hit a rock. Both of them are launched through the windshield (what's a seatbelt?), and tumble down the side of the mountain for quite a while.

When they finally come to a stop, Disha gets up and appears to only have suffered a bit of a bump on the head. She runs over to where Amar is lying face down in the snow. When she turns him over, she sees that he's bashed his face in on a large rock, and is not looking too good. She looks back up the hill and sees Das and a few cops have arrived at the scene. They call to Disha to come back to the road, but she refuses to leave Amar's side.

As they continue to call to her, giant snowflakes begin to fall. They rapidly get heavy and begin covering Amar's fallen form. A distant rumbling shows an avalanche (!!) bearing down on them from up the mountain. It sweeps Disha away, and buries Amar's body under many feet of snow. As soon as Disha is gone, we snap back to the present and see Mavan still standing on the side of the mountain. He has a quick flashback to the night where Kabir thought he saw a wall of ice, and of the time Disha was choking on her necklace. As he ponders the meaning of all this, the camera does a big swooping crane move, and shows us that Disha's spirit is hiding behind a rock that's nearby.

This doesn't lead to anything, so let's go back to Sunita's place and tell her what we've learned. Manav asks why Disha waited so long to make her move on him in this incarnation. Sunita figures that she wanted to be reunited with Amar when he was at the same age as when she lost him. She also goes on to explain things we already know, like how Disha had the book hidden, and killed everyone when they read it so her secret wouldn't be revealed. She also apparently engineered Manav's discovery of his old body to shock the memories back into him. Sunita finally figures out what Disha has been planning. Manav will have to surrender his life in the same place that Amar died, and he must do so willingly or else Disha will not be appeased. Shanti asks if there's some way that Disha can be stopped without anyone else dying. Sunita tells her that they can, but they must wait until Manav and Shanti are married on their selected date. After that, Manav will be forever bound to Shanti, and Disha can't do anything about it.

Manav is worried that by doing this, he'll be putting Shanti's life in danger. Sunita points out the rather obvious fact that unless they do something to end Disha's reign of terror, all of their lives are in danger. Shanti takes Manav aside and says that this is a test for them, and she is willing to face the risks. Manav swears that whatever happens he will defend her in life or in death.

Now that that's out of the way, they head off to the room with all the candles to have the wedding ceremony. As the ceremony is being performed, we see they are back inside the protective circle, and Sunita is patrolling the room with her snowflake pendant to ward of Disha if she should make an appearance. Tensions are high as the ceremony carries on, but things appear to be progressing smoothly.

That is until the time for Manav and Shanti to walk around the fire. We start to see flashes of the cottage, and a quick glimpse of those emerald eyes snapping open again.
